DI_a082_accelTrack2
PULL OVER IMMEDIATELY - Unable to drive
What does the DI_a082_accelTrack2 alert mean?
The drive interface (DI) electronic control unit (ECU) detects an issue with the accelerator pedal sensor track 2, indicating that the DI may not be able to accurately track pedal position.
What you'll see in your Tesla
- PULL OVER IMMEDIATELY - Unable to drive
- Exiting and re-entering vehicle may restore operation
What triggers it
The DI ECU receives irrational input from accel track 2.
When it clears
A drive cycle is executed and the DI ECU detects that the condition is no longer present.
Potential impact
The vehicle cannot drive.
Affected models
Cybertruck
Model 3 2017-2023
Model 3 2024+
Model S 2021+
Model X 2021+
Model Y
Model Y 2025+
Semitruck
